Bitcoin Bitcoin kr 700,143.00 1.18% | Ethereum Ethereum kr 21,417.00 2.47% | XRP XRP kr 13.23 1.44% | BNB BNB kr 5,832.97 0.39% | Solana Solana kr 793.11 1.31% | TRON TRON kr 3.12 1.61% | Figure Heloc Figure Heloc kr 9.70 0.00% | Dogecoin Dogecoin kr 0.88 0.89% | WhiteBIT Coin WhiteBIT Coin kr 507.57 1.34% | Hyperliquid Hyperliquid kr 385.99 5.11% | LEO Token LEO Token kr 95.12 0.62% | Cardano Cardano kr 2.31 1.09% | Bitcoin Cash Bitcoin Cash kr 4,112.23 1.53% | Chainlink Chainlink kr 86.15 0.63% | Monero Monero kr 3,308.29 0.03% | Canton Canton kr 1.41 2.52% | MemeCore MemeCore kr 30.57 9.92% | Stellar Stellar kr 1.58 1.45% | Zcash Zcash kr 2,934.75 2.82% | USD1 USD1 kr 9.38 0.16% | Litecoin Litecoin kr 512.18 1.80% | PayPal USD PayPal USD kr 9.38 0.15% | Avalanche Avalanche kr 85.74 1.84% | Hedera Hedera kr 0.83 0.32% | Sui Sui kr 8.79 1.43% | Rain Rain kr 0.07 0.61% | Toncoin Toncoin kr 12.23 1.74% | Cronos Cronos kr 0.65 0.88% | Circle USYC Circle USYC kr 10.65 0.00% | Tether Gold Tether Gold kr 44,796.00 0.11% | BlackRock USD Institutional Digital Liquidity Fund BlackRock USD Institutional Digital Liquidity Fund kr 9.39 0.18% | World Liberty Financial World Liberty Financial kr 0.73 1.51% | PAX Gold PAX Gold kr 44,833.00 0.17% | Bittensor Bittensor kr 2,283.66 0.54% | Global Dollar Global Dollar kr 9.38 0.17% | Polkadot Polkadot kr 11.85 0.88% | Uniswap Uniswap kr 30.72 1.05% | Mantle Mantle kr 5.80 5.18% | Sky Sky kr 0.72 1.72% |

Hva er OAuth

Hva er OAuth

Hva er OAuth. I den digitale tidsalderen, hvor informasjonsutveksling på tvers av plattformer er vanlig, har behovet for sikker og standardisert autorisasjon blitt stadig viktigere. OAuth, forkortelse for Open Authorization, er en sentral aktør i dette landskapet og gir oss en mekanisme for å dele ressurser på nettet uten å utsette sikkerheten til våre personlige påloggingsdetaljer.

I vår komplekse digitale virkelighet, hvor vi deler og får tilgang til informasjon fra et mangfold av plattformer, understreker nødvendigheten av sikker og standardisert autorisasjon. Her trer OAuth inn som limet som forener våre digitale interaksjoner, og det gir oss en protokoll for å delegere begrenset tilgang til beskyttede ressurser uten å avsløre sensitive legitimasjonsdetaljer.

Hvordan Fungerer OAuth

La oss nå belyse hvordan OAuth løser en konkret utfordring: Hvordan kan vi dele private bilder på sosiale medieplattformer med apper fra tredjeparter uten å utlevere våre påloggingspassord?

Autorisasjonssøknad

Dette er starten på prosessen. Appen ber først om tillatelse til å få tilgang til bildene dine på Instagram. Du gir din godkjennelse, og som respons mottar du en autorisasjonskode.

Autorisasjonskodeutveksling

Deretter sender appen denne autorisasjonskoden til Instagrams autorisasjonsserver. Dette trinnet likner på å overlevere en nøkkel gjennom et sikkert vindu. Instagram bekrefter koden og gir appen en midlertidig nøkkel, kalt en tilgangstoken.

Tilgangstokenutveksling

Appen bruker nå denne tilgangstokenen til å hente bildene fra Instagram-kontoen din uten å be om passordet ditt.

Hvorfor er dette Viktig

  • Sikkerhet:
    • OAuth gir et ekstra sikkerhetslag rundt påloggingsdetaljene dine. Appen får tilgang uten å kjenne ditt faktiske passord.
  • Brukerkontroll:
    • Du har styringen. Du avgjør hvilke tjenester som får tilgang til dataene dine, og du kan trekke tilbake tillatelsen når som helst.
  • Tredjepartsintegrasjon:
    • Apputviklere kan bygge funksjoner som krever tilgang til dataene dine uten å håndtere påloggingsdetaljene direkte.

Implementering av OAuth

OAuth implementeres gjennom en intrikat kombinasjon av autorisasjonskode, klient-ID, klienthemmelighet, tilgangstoken og oppfriskningstoken. Denne komplekse, men nødvendige, prosessen utgjør en robust metode for å autorisere tredjepartsapplikasjoner. Det er som å sette sammen puslespillbrikker for å danne en digital murstein i sikkerhetsveggen rundt dine digitale verdier.

Praktiske Eksempler på OAuth i Bruk

  1. Sosiale Mediepålogging:
    • Når du bruker tredjepartsapper og nettsteder som ber om tilgang til din Facebook-, Google- eller Twitter-konto, bruker de ofte OAuth.
  2. Deling av Bilder:
    • Applikasjoner som tillater deg å dele bilder direkte på sosiale medieplattformer som Facebook eller Instagram bruker OAuth for sikker og begrenset tilgang.
  3. E-posttjenester:
    • E-postklienter og apper fra tredjepartsleverandører, for eksempel Outlook eller Thunderbird, kan be om tilgang til e-postkontoen din ved hjelp av OAuth.
  4. Kalenderintegrering:
    • Når du kobler kalenderappen din til en tredjepartsapplikasjon, bruker de ofte OAuth for å få tilgang til din kalenderinformasjon.
  5. Online Lagringstjenester:
    • Tjenester som Dropbox eller Google Drive bruker OAuth når du kobler dem til andre applikasjoner.
  6. Betalingstjenester:
    • Tredjepartstjenester som PayPal kan bruke OAuth for å utføre transaksjoner på dine vegne.

Praktiske eksempler viser hvordan OAuth effektivt gir brukere kontroll og sikkerhet ved å tillate begrenset tilgang til ulike plattformer uten å avsløre sensitive påloggingsdetaljer. På denne måten fungerer OAuth som en nøkkelspiller i sikringen av våre digitale interaksjoner.

Legg igjen en kommentar

Din e-postadresse vil ikke bli publisert. Obligatoriske felt er merket med *

Skroll til toppen